Does the low credit card limit matter?
With the popularity of credit cards, many people have applied for credit cards, but there are also many people who want to cancel their credit cards because of their low credit limit. Does the low credit card limit matter?

Does the low credit card limit matter?

The low credit card limit has an impact on selling cards. If the low-value credit card is cancelled, the bank will apply for the same bank credit card next time, and the qualification of the applicant will be stricter than that of the first-time application user. If the qualifications are average, the rejection rate may be high. In addition, the cancellation of a credit card application will be displayed on the personal credit report, and other banks will also check it when applying for another bank's credit card next time, which may affect the application of other credit cards.

When you apply for a credit card for the first time, the amount is often low. Don't apply for a card refund just because the credit card limit is low. Cardholders can use credit cards for consumption, use credit cards rationally and increase the credit card quota.
